Mar 5, 2024Warning IssuedRoutine Inspection

Violations found and a warning issued, with a return visit required. 5 recorded.

0 High priority3 Intermediate2 Basic
Show 5 findings ▾
Establishment preparing food using a method that has been determined by the Divisions of Hotels and Restaurants to require an approved variance from the Division. Establishment does not have an approved variance for the method observed in use during the inspection. Establishment cutting cabbage adding seasoning letting food sit in cooler for 1 week then serving food item for an additional week.
Intermediate/03G-46-1/Warning
Operator is doing a special process, conducting reduced oxygen packaging, cooking time/temperature control for safety food to a time and temperature combination lesser than those in the Food Code or operating a molluscan shellfish tank for human consumption without a HACCP plan approved by the Division of Hotels and Restaurants. Establishment cutting cabbage adding seasoning letting food sit in cooler for 1 week then serving food item for an additional week.
Intermediate/03G-50-1/Warning
Packaged food not labeled as specified by law. Cookies made and packaged at a local licensed bakery sold at this establishment lacking any type of labeling.
Intermediate/02D-02-4
Equipment in poor repair. Cutting board (on reach cooler by ice machine) edges are no longer smooth and easily cleanable. Reach in cooler with exposed insulation on door (by keg cooler).
Basic/14-11-5
Standing water in bottom of reach-in-cooler. Inside keg cooler.
Basic/29-49-6
